Modern cars come with key fobs, which have a separate battery. The most commonly used car key battery replacement is the CR2032 battery that is inexpensive and readily available at stores like Batteries Plus.
To change the batteries in your key fob, you'll have to open it. The majority of key fobs come with an elongated clamshell design. It has two halves that snap together. You usually open the key fob with fingers or a butter knife. Certain key fobs are more difficult to open and require an screwdriver.
After the two halves have been separated, you will be able to see the circuit board and the battery. Be sure not to lose any cables or screws during this process. Take a picture or write down the orientation of the battery that was used in the key fob to ensure you can replace it in the same place.
Place the new battery in the same place as the previous one. Be sure to verify whether the new battery has both a positive and negative side. Once the battery has been installed and plugged in, you can put the circuit board over it and snap back the two halves together.

In the beginning, you'll need to find the old car key battery. You can find a symbol on the back or top of the battery, which is easily seen with a magnifying lens. You can also refer to the owner's guide for your car or ask someone at the service department at your dealer to identify the type you need.
Once you've located the right battery It's time to replace the old one! With a flat screwdriver or a coin, gently pry open the fob along the seam. Be careful not to damage the plastic casing or any electronic components inside. After you've opened the fob, carefully remove the old battery, taking note of which side is positive and which negative to ensure you insert the new battery in the same direction.
Install a new battery, then snap the two halves of the fob together. Make sure you test the key fob prior to you leave to ensure the replacement battery is working properly. If everything goes well, you are now ready to go!

First, you'll need to open the key fob. This process varies by manufacturer, but you'll usually need to use an flat screwdriver or a strong fingernail to pry the fob apart at the seam. You should be careful to avoid damaging any internal components while opening your key fob.
Remove the old battery once you've opened the fob. It should pop out easily thanks to an inbuilt spring If not try using multiple locations around the fob and
